Conmed Disposable Kit HA-222DK
The Disposable Kit HA-222DK is a single-use hip arthroscopy access pack that provides essential instruments for initial joint entry. It includes a distention needle, two guidewires, a cannulated switching stick, two Hex Flex cannulas (8.0 × 120 mm) and a banana blade. It is designed to facilitate minimally invasive access into the hip joint.
This access kit is engineered to streamline the initial portal creation phase of hip arthroscopy by offering a ready-to-use sterile set of disposable components. The inclusion of the distention needle and guidewires supports safe fluid/air distention and access channel establishment. The cannulated switching stick and Hex Flex® cannulas allow the surgeon to quickly insert and maintain working channels while introducing instruments. The banana blade included in the kit enables controlled soft-tissue release or capsulotomy as part of the hip access workflow.
Technical Specification
| Specification | Value |
|---|---|
| Catalog / Part Number | HA-222DK |
| Product Type | Hip Arthroscopy Disposable Kit (initial access instruments) |
| Included Components | Distention needle, 2 guidewires, cannulated switching stick, 2 Hex Flex cannulas (8.0 × 120 mm), banana blade |
| Intended Use | Single-use kit for establishing portal access in hip arthroscopy |
| System Compatibility | Works within the Hip Preservation System access instruments from CONMED |
